Preferred, but Not Required * Experience with IP cameras, LPR technology, RFID equipment, industrial computers, kiosks, printers, or other connected devices. * Familiarity with serial communications, USB devices, APIs, device drivers, or IoT equipment. * Experience using network diagnostic tools such as ping, traceroute, IP scanners, or packet-capture software. * Experience working in industrial, construction-materials, trucking, logistics, manufacturing, or outdoor operating environments. * Previous technical-support, computer-repair, installation, field-service, or help-desk experience., * Computer related technical support and service: 2 years (Required) ## Description We are seeking a motivated, hands-on Hardware & Network Integration Technician to help test, configure, and deploy the hardware and connected devices used with our SaaS platform. This is an entry-level opportunity for someone who enjoys working with computers, networking, cameras, electronics, and other technical equipment. The technician will evaluate new devices in a controlled test environment and may also travel to customer locations to conduct field trials for new hardware, workflows, and use cases. The ideal candidate is curious, technically inclined, organized, and comfortable troubleshooting problems both independently and with customers and internal team members. Key Responsibilities * Set up, configure, test, and troubleshoot hardware used with our SaaS application. * Evaluate device compatibility, reliability, connectivity, and performance. * Test equipment such as: * License plate recognition (LPR) and IP cameras * RFID readers, antennas, tags, and related equipment * Industrial touchscreen computers and kiosks * Printers, scanners, scale indicators, and other peripheral devices * Network switches, routers, wireless equipment, and cellular devices * Configure basic wired and wireless networks, including IP addresses, ports, device communication, and connectivity. * Create test scenarios that reflect real-world customer operating environments. * Document test procedures, equipment settings, results, issues, and recommended configurations. * Work with product development, implementation, support, and customer-facing teams to resolve hardware and integration issues. * Assist with onsite customer trials and pilot installations for new devices, applications, and workflows. * Observe customer operations and recommend ways to improve hardware placement, configuration, and usability. * Communicate findings clearly to both technical and nontechnical team members. * Maintain test equipment, inventory, cabling, tools, and lab work areas. * Assist with preparing and configuring hardware before it is shipped or installed at a customer location. * Stay current on relevant hardware, networking, camera, RFID, and industrial-computing technologies., A successful technician will be able to take a new piece of hardware, understand how it communicates, connect it to our platform, test it under realistic conditions, identify potential problems, and clearly document the recommended setup.
